Condition: Used, Excellent
SP Luthier Notes: A majority of frets showed evidence of play wear. As such, the frets were leveled, recrowned, and polished back to a near mint state. The guitar required a full adjustment to the truss rod, nut, and bridge to be brought to a perfect level of playability. (A) Minor dent(s) present on the guitar required our luthier to fill, color match, and refinish the area massively improving the cosmetics of the guitar. No further work was required.

Body: Mahogany
Top: Maple
Neck: Mahogany
Fretboard: Rosewood
Inlays: Abalone
Truss Rod Cover: Abalone
Bridge/Tailpiece: Locking; Chrome
Tuners: Sperzel Locking; Chrome
Pickups: DiMarzio Zodiac (custom model for McInturff guitars); 1x bridge 1x neck
Nut Width: 1.71"
Scale Length: 25.5"
Radius: 12"
Switch: 2x vol, 1x tone, 1x 5-way blade switch
Output Jack: Puretone
Weight: 8lbs, 11oz
*all measurements taken by hand at Soundpure
